How Our Concrete Slab Water Extraction Process Works
When you call us for concrete slab water extraction, you can expect a seamless process that reduces disruption to your daily life. Our team will assess the damage, extract the water, and dry your property to prevent further damage. We’ll work with your insurance company to ensure a smooth claims process, and we’ll keep you informed every step of the way.
Step 1: Assessment and Planning
Our technicians will arrive at your property to assess the damage and create a customized plan to extract the water and dry your concrete slab. We’ll use specialized equipment to detect hidden moisture and identify the source of the leak.
Step 2: Water Extraction
Our team will use powerful pumps and vacuums to extract the water from your concrete slab, removing up to 2 inches of standing water in a single pass. We’ll also use specialized equipment to dry the surrounding areas to prevent further damage.
Step 3: Drying and Dehumidification
Our technicians will use industrial-grade dehumidifiers to remove excess moisture from the air, ensuring your property is dry and safe. We’ll also monitor the drying process to ensure everything is working as planned.
Step 4: Cleaning and Sanitizing
Once the water is extracted and the area is dry, our team will clean and sanitize the affected area to prevent mold and bacterial growth. We’ll use eco-friendly cleaning products to ensure your property is safe and healthy.
Step 5: Final Inspection and Touch-ups
Our technicians will conduct a final inspection to ensure your property is dry and safe. We’ll make any necessary touch-ups to ensure your concrete slab is restored to its original condition.

Concrete Slab Water Extraction Cost in Falcon Heights, MN
The cost of concrete slab water extraction varies based on the severity of the damage, the size of the affected area, and local conditions in Falcon Heights, MN. Our estimates are free and based on an on-site assessment. We’ll work with your insurance company to ensure a smooth claims process and provide a customized solution to meet your specific needs and budget.
| Service | Typical Price Range | What Affects Cost |
|---|---|---|
| Assessment and planning | $100 – $500 | Severity of damage and size of affected area |
| Water extraction | $500 – $2,500 | Size of affected area and type of equipment needed |
| Drying and dehumidification | $500 – $2,000 | Size of affected area and type of equipment needed |
| Cleaning and sanitizing | $200 – $1,000 | Size of affected area and type of cleaning products needed |
| Final inspection and touch-ups | $100 – $500 | Size of affected area and type of repairs needed |
Exact pricing depends on an on-site assessment and the specifics of your situation. We offer free estimates and work with your insurance company to ensure a smooth claims process.

Common Questions About Concrete Slab Water Extraction
How long does concrete slab water extraction take?
Our team can extract water from a concrete slab within 60 minutes, but the drying process can take up to 3-5 days, depending on the severity of the damage and the size of the affected area.
Is concrete slab water extraction covered by insurance?
Yes, concrete slab water extraction is typically covered by homeowners’ insurance policies. We’ll work with your insurance company to ensure a smooth claims process.
Can I do concrete slab water extraction myself?
While small leaks can be handled DIY, large water damage needs specialized equipment and expertise to extract the water and dry the slab. Our team is IICRC-certified and equipped to handle even the toughest water extraction jobs.
How do I prevent concrete slab water damage?
Regular maintenance, such as inspecting your plumbing and water supply lines, can help prevent concrete slab water damage. You can also consider installing a sump pump or French drain to redirect water away from your property.
